Holstein Manufacturing Inc. Towable Gas Grill (Model 7240G)

The Towable Gas Grill is available for employee use and is perfect for campus events, cookouts, tailgates, or department gatherings. This heavy duty, propane-fueled grill offers a large cooking surface and reliable performance, making it ideal for serving groups of all sizes. Mounted on a trailer for easy transport, it includes bult-in side tables and a secure hitch for towing.

 

Description

  • Gas
  • UL Approved
  • Cooking dimensions: 72″ Long x 40″ Wide
  • Cooking Area: 20 sq. ft.
  • Overall Dimensions: 140″ Long x 60″ Wide x 62″ Tall
  • 36″ grilling surface height
  • Heavy 14-gauge steel construction
  • Stainless steel grates from 5/16″ ss rod
  • Stainless steel rotisserie from 5/16″ ss rod
  • 110-volt, 2 RPM electric rotisserie motor
  • 2 Flip-up side doors
  • Temperature gauge
  • Grease drip tray under rotisserie
  • 13″ tires
  • 1800 lb. pay load per axle and fenders
  • 2″ trailer hitch & heavy-duty jack
  • Turn signals & brake lights with flat four-way plug
  • Automatic thermostat and pilot light
  • Gas valve and gas regulator
  • Adjustable and individually controlled pipe burners
  • Angle iron grease deflectors above burners
  • Swing-away lower door allows for easy cleaning and pilot light maintenance
  • Removable wire mesh grill rock trays above burners
  • Grease drip tray under grill frame
  • 2 – 40 lb. propane tanks
  • Includes Rear Mounted Serving Table

Grill Return & Cleaning Policy

All employees who reserve and use the Towable Gas Grill are responsible for returning it to the same location as picked up in clean and acceptable condition.

Towable Gas Grill Policy Guidelines

All renters are responsible for returning rented property in the same condition it was received, allowing for normal wear and tear. Any damage beyond normal wear and tear, will result in an assessment of damages and corresponding fees.

The grill must be thoroughly cleaned after use. This includes:

  • Removing all food debris and grease from grates and surfaces
  • Emptying and wiping down grease trays
  • Cleaning side table and any additional prep areas
  • Ensuring no trash or leftover supplies are left behind
  • Return Towable Gas Grill with full propane tank after use (Propane refills can be obtained at Hometown Building Center, 742 Highway 50 W Linn, Mo.)
  • Event coordinator will be responsible for collecting and returning the Towable Gas Grill Keys to the Key Lockbox located in the college’s Mailroom.

Assessment Process:

  1. Inspection: All rented property will be inspected upon return. A staff member will document the condition.
  2. Damage Evaluation: If damage is found, it will be evaluated to determine:
    • The extent of the damage
    • Whether the item is repairable or must be replaced
    • The cost of repair or replacement
  3. Cleanliness Evaluation: Fees are determined based on the time, supplies, and labor needed to restore the property to an acceptable standard

Fee Structure:

Damage Fees will be based on one or more of the following:

  • Minor Damages: (e.g., scratches, small stains, minor wear outside of normal use) Flat fee ranging from $25–$75 depending on item and extent of damage.
  • Moderate Damages: (e.g., broken parts, deep stains, dents, partial loss of function) Repair cost or fee between $75–$250, based on professional estimate or actual repair invoice.
  • Severe Damages or Total Loss: (e.g., irreparable damage, missing items, destruction of property) Full replacement cost of the item, including shipping and administrative processing.

 

Cleaning Fees will be based on one or more of the following:

  • Light Cleaning Required: (e.g., wiping down surfaces, emptying trash, minimal effort) Flat fee of $25-$50.
  • Moderate Cleaning Required: (e.g., extensive food residue, dirty equipment, disorganized materials) Fee of $50–$100.
  • Heavy Cleaning Required: (e.g., grease buildup, trash left behind, equipment left in unsanitary condition) Fee of $100–$200, or actual cleaning cost if professional services are required.

Billing and Payment:

  • Renters will receive an itemized damage report.
  • Payment is due within 15 days of the invoice date.
  • Failure to pay damage fees may result in additional penalties, denial of future rental privileges, or collection action.
  • Payments MUST be made with the Campus Cashier by debit card, credit card or check. (Checks payable to State Tech)

Appeals:

Renters may appeal for a damage assessment in writing within 5 business days of receiving the damage report. Appeals should include any supporting documentation or explanation. Appeals will be reviewed by the appropriate supervisor, and a final decision will be communicated within 10 business days.
